The campsite is accesable by all weather unsealed roads suitable for 2wd vehicles
From Dalmorton turn onto Chaelundi Road, cross the Boyd River then you will find the campsite about 500m further on your right.
General Information
You can park a trailer, or a tent in this campground - but no caravans There are a total of 20 campsitesEnjoy the water and the history in the local town and area. Do not camp to close to the water as it is still in use as a travelling stock reserve.

Fees
Camping fees applyAdult=$3 Per NightChildern=$2 Per Night
No car entry fees applyVehicle=$0 Per Day
Facilities
Toilets Pit or composting toilets are available
Showers No showers are provided on site
Water No drinking water onsite - bring your own water
Picnic Tables Picnic tables are provided on site
Pit fire BBQs Wood fired Pit BBQ's are provided - bring your own wood
Electric of Gas BBQs Gas or electric BBQ's are not provided
Rubbish Bins No rubbish bins provided - take your own rubbish with you
Fuel Stove only area This is not a Fuel stove only area.
